Last split was 2:1 on 7/14/97, a day ahead of the 1997 Q2 earnings report. That split was actually announced with the 1996 Q4 earnings on 1/14/97, at which point INTC had been above 120 for over 2 months. The actual split had to wait at least until the AGM on 5/21/97 for an increase in the amount of authorized common stock to 4.5 billion shares.

With 1.66 billion shares currently outstanding, INTC could announce a 2:1 split, but it would almost certainly come with an earnings report, and it hasn't.

IMO a split now would be premature since the share price needs to maintain 120+ for a month or two at least, and it's only been there a week or two. Looks like we'll have to wait for the Q2 earnings in April, but if the stock price holds over 110-120, it's a virtual certainty to occur then.
